Oh and Kao the Kangaroo 2 on the GameCube

It takes 1 player instructions from the controller furthest to the right. So if you've got four controllers plugged in you can only play with controller 4. The only way you can play with player 1's controller is to remove any other controllers in the GameCube.

This alone should NEVER happen.
